If at or before the hearing there is filed with the board of supervisors a petition signed by not less than 200 voters of the county objecting to the abandonment, the board of supervisors shall either terminate the proceedings or submit the question of abandonment to the voters of the county at the next statewide election or at a special election called for that purpose.
